Alongside the unified model APIs, we expose compatibility APIs that take each vendor's original parameters exactly as the vendor defines them — nothing renamed, nothing reshaped on the way through.
That makes them the shortest path onto Picsart if you already work with the vendor directly: the request bodies you've already written keep working as they are. You keep their parameter names and defaults, and you get the vendor's full parameter set rather than the subset that is shared across every model.
The cost is that a request is written for one vendor — switching models later means rewriting it, and results come back in the vendor's own shape. When you'd rather write once and change models freely, use the unified API.
Make a request
Call the workflow with ai.apis.run() in TypeScript, or hit /workflows/{workflow}/execute directly — params is passed through untouched either way.
These endpoints are addressed by workflow name rather than model id: the one in this model's header, since one model runs as one workflow. Authentication is unchanged — your Picsart API key as a bearer token (see Authentication).
import { createClient, ApiRunMode } from '@picsart/ai-sdk';
const ai = createClient({
apiKey: process.env.PICSART_API_KEY,
apiUrl: 'https://api.picsart.com',
});
// Calls the 'gemini/v1/audios' workflow directly — params are sent as-is.
const { result, usage } = await ai.apis.run('gemini/v1/audios', {
text: "Hello, welcome to our product demo.",
model: "gemini-2.5-flash-tts"
}, {
mode: ApiRunMode.SYNC,
});
console.log(result); // workflow-specific output
console.log(usage?.credits); // credits chargedAsync (submit & poll)
This model can run longer than the sync limit (~20s). In TypeScript, ai.apis.run(…, { mode: ApiRunMode.ASYNC }) polls for you; over HTTP, submit and poll yourself.

5 parameters, sent inside params. These are the vendor's own names, so they line up one-for-one with the vendor's documentation. Required ones must be supplied; the rest fall back to their defaults.
| Parameter | Type | Required | Default | Details |
|---|---|---|---|---|
textText to synthesize into speech | string | yes | — | — |
modelTTS model to use | string | yes | — | gemini-2.5-flash-ttsgemini-2.5-pro-tts |
voiceNameVoice name for single-speaker TTS | string | no | — | PuckKoreCharonFenrirAoedeLedaZephyrOrusAutonoeCallirrhoeDespinaErinomeGacruxLaomedeiaPulcherrimaSulafatVindemiatrixAchernarAchirdAlgenibAlgiebaAlnilamEnceladusIapetusRasalgethiSadachbiaSadaltagerSchedarUmbrielZubenelgenubi |
multiSpeakerVoiceConfigsMulti-speaker voice configs (max 2). When provided, voiceName is ignored. | SpeakerVoiceConfigDto[] | no | — | max 2 items |
└ speakerSpeaker identifier (e.g. "Speaker 1") | string | yes | — | — |
└ voiceNameVoice name for this speaker | string | yes | — | PuckKoreCharonFenrirAoedeLedaZephyrOrusAutonoeCallirrhoeDespinaErinomeGacruxLaomedeiaPulcherrimaSulafatVindemiatrixAchernarAchirdAlgenibAlgiebaAlnilamEnceladusIapetusRasalgethiSadachbiaSadaltagerSchedarUmbrielZubenelgenubi |
optionsOptions controlling safety checks and drive integration | object | no | — | — |
└ safety_checksSafety check settings | object | no | — | — |
└ enabledWhether to run content moderation. Defaults to true. | boolean | no | — | — |
└ driveSave result to Picsart Drive | object | no | — | — |
└ nameFile name in Picsart Drive | string | yes | — | — |
└ attributesCustom attributes to attach to the file | object | no | — | — |
└ folderTarget folder in Picsart Drive | object | no | — | — |
Response
Over HTTP the output arrives inside a status envelope, at response.result. ai.apis.run() unwraps that envelope for you and resolves to { result, usage } instead. Either way the resultitself is the vendor's own shape.
{
"result": {
"audioUrls": [
{
"url": "https://cdn.picsart.com/…/result.mp3",
"mimeType": "audio/mpeg",
"driveFile": {}
}
]
},
"usage": {
"credits": 0
}
}
